Why Choose Shenzhen for Foreign-Funded Companies?

Shenzhen offers unparalleled advantages for foreign investors. The city’s Special Economic Zone (SEZ) status provides tax incentives, simplified administrative procedures, and access to cutting-edge infrastructure. Additionally, Shenzhen’s proximity to Hong Kong facilitates cross-border trade and logistics. Foreign-funded companies in Shenzhen enjoy the same market opportunities as domestic enterprises, with sectors like technology, manufacturing, and services thriving in the region.


Key Steps to Register a Foreign-Funded Company in Shenzhen

Establishing a foreign-funded company in Shenzhen involves several critical steps. First, investors must decide on the business structure—common options include Wholly Foreign-Owned Enterprises (WFOEs), Joint Ventures, or Representative Offices. Next, the registration process requires submitting documents such as the company’s Articles of Association, proof of legal entity status (e.g., passport for foreign individuals or notarized certificates for overseas corporations), and details of the proposed business scope.


Foreign investors must also secure a registered address in Shenzhen. Streamlined Timelines and Cost-Efficient Solutions

The timeline for establishing a foreign-funded company in Shenzhen typically ranges from 2 to 5 working days, depending on document preparation and approval processes. Key milestones include:

- Company Name Approval: 1 working day.

- Business License Issuance: 1–3 working days.

- Company Seal Engraving: 2 working days.

- Bank Account Setup: 1 working day.

Compliance and Operational Support

Post-registration, foreign-funded companies must prioritize tax compliance and financial management. Shenzhen mandates monthly or quarterly tax filings, depending on business scale. Partnering with experienced accountants ensures accurate bookkeeping and timely submissions using professional financial software. Additionally, maintaining a valid Chinese mobile number for the legal representative and updating business licenses annually are critical for uninterrupted operations.
